First of all, if this thread already exists, someone point me in the right direction to find it. If it doesn't, it needs to.
With the addition of the "Random" character slot, allowing players to play random characters easier, it has become possible for someone to become a Random mainer.
The ability to play as anyone and win regardless of the situation is a true sign of skill, so I decided to make this thread. This way, all of those who can (and will) play as anyone, those who like to leave the character up to chance, and those who just don't have trouble picking a main, can find each other. To add your name to the list, put your username and any particular characters you're good/bad with. List Sheik as a separate character; list PS Samus, ZS Samus, or Samus for both; list PT if you are good/bad with at least 2 of the pokemon, otherwise list the pokemon's name.
Also, feel free to discuss general strategies for types of characters you're bad at (i.e., heavy characters, fast characters, etc.). For individual characters, go to that character's board.

Y'know, I'm having a hard time understanding why Olimar is so difficult for some many people to learn.

Tis a curious thing.
He's one of the harder characters to learn partly because he's so different from the rest of the cast. Separate spacing, timing, damage on all 5 versions of any move he could do. He's basic for beating crappy players with. But so is anyone...
